Rehearsal

I love pizza. Unfortunately, I can never remember the phone number for pizza delivery and I’m not smart enough to write it down. So I have to call information for the number. To make sure I don’t forget the number from the time the operator tells me to the time I dial it, I engage in rehearsal — consciously repeating the information over and over so that I can keep it in temporary memory. Rehearsal can also be used to encode it for long-term memory storage, but I can’t seem to get it in there and so I have to call the operator every time.
